Enable job alerts via email!

Full-stack Software Engineer (AI Vision Systems)

Ford Motor Company

Redford (MI)

On-site

USD 100,000 - 140,000

Full time

12 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Ford Motor Company is seeking an experienced Full-Stack Software Engineer to work on innovative AI Vision Systems, focusing on developing machine learning models for edge devices. This role offers the opportunity to collaborate with diverse teams and build cutting-edge software solutions while enjoying a comprehensive benefits package.

Benefits

Immediate medical, dental, vision and prescription coverage
Flexible family care days and paid parental leave
Tuition assistance
Paid time off for community service
Vehicle discount program for employees
Paid holidays, including the week between Christmas and New Year’s

Qualifications

  • 5+ years of software engineering experience.
  • Strong understanding of AI and computer vision.
  • Experience with machine learning models on edge devices.

Responsibilities

  • Develop and deploy machine learning models for AI vision systems.
  • Integrate with Google Cloud-based databases for data management.
  • Collaborate with cross-functional teams to drive technical solutions.

Skills

Programming in Python
JavaScript (Node.js)
AI and Computer Vision
Database Management
RESTful API Development
Containerization (Docker, Kubernetes)
Problem-Solving

Education

Bachelor’s or Master’s Degree in Computer Science or Engineering

Tools

Google Cloud
Jira

Job description

We are seeking an experienced Full-Stack Software Engineer to join our dynamic team working on cutting-edge AI Vision Systems. You will be responsible for developing and maintaining software that powers machine learning models running on edge PCs, interacting with APIs, and managing data with a Google-based database backend. This is a hands-on role that combines both front-end and back-end development skills, along with a passion for building innovative solutions in the field of AI and computer vision.

Qualifications

Minimum Requirements:

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field (or equivalent work experience).
  • 5+ years of professional software engineering experience.
  • Experience developing machine learning models and deploying them on edge devices (e.g., NVIDIA Jetson, Raspberry Pi).
  • Strong understanding of AI and computer vision concepts.
  • Experience with cloud databases, specifically Google Cloud platforms
  • Proficiency in programming languages such as Python, JavaScript (Node.js), Angular, and C#
  • Experience building RESTful APIs and working with web technologies (HTML, CSS, JavaScript, React, or similar frameworks).
  • Familiarity with containerization (Docker, Kubernetes) and CI/CD pipelines.
  • Utilization of Jira for issues management and planning

Preferred Qualifications:

  • Experience with AI frameworks like TensorFlow, PyTorch, or OpenCV.
  • Knowledge of edge computing frameworks and optimizations
  • Understanding of real-time data processing, streaming technologies, and protocols
  • Familiarity with version control systems
  • Strong problem-solving skills and ability to work in a fast-paced, collaborative environment.

You may not check every box, or your experience may look a little different from what we've outlined, but if you think you can bring value to Ford Motor Company, we encourage you to apply!

As an established global company, we offer the benefit of choice. You can choose what your Ford future will look like: will your story span the globe, or keep you close to home? Will your career be a deep dive into what you love, or a series of new teams and new skills? Will you be a leader, a changemaker, a technical expert, a culture builder…or all of the above? No matter what you choose, we offer a work life that works for you, including:

• Immediate medical, dental, vision and prescription drug coverage

• Flexible family care days, paid parental leave, new parent ramp-up programs, subsidized back-up childcare and more

• Family building benefits including adoption and surrogacy expense reimbursement, fertility treatments, and more

• Vehicle discount program for employees and family members and management leases

• Tuition assistance

• Established and active employee resource groups

• Paid time off for individual and team community service

• A generous schedule of paid holidays, including the week between Christmas and New Year’s Day

• Paid time off and the option to purchase additional vacation time.


For a detailed look at our benefits, click here:
https://fordcareers.co/GSRnon-HTHD


This position is salary grade range 5-8.

Visa sponsorship is available for this position.

Relocation assistance is available for this position.


Candidates for positions with Ford Motor Company must be legally authorized to work in the United States. Verification of employment eligibility will be required at the time of hire.


We are an Equal Opportunity Employer committed to a culturally diverse workforce. All qualified applicants will receive consideration for employment without regard to race, religion, color, age, sex, national origin, sexual orientation, gender identity, disability status or protected veteran status. In the United States, if you need a reasonable accommodation for the online application process due to a disability, please call 1-888-336-0660.

#LI-Onsite

#LI-MH5

Responsibilities

What you'll do…

  • AI Vision Systems Development: Design, develop, and deploy machine learning models to run on edge PCs for AI vision systems, focusing on performance optimization for real-time applications.
  • Edge Computing: Implement software solutions to optimize processing of machine learning models directly on edge devices, ensuring low-latency and high-performance vision system functionality.
  • Full-Stack Development: Build scalable and secure web-based interfaces, APIs, and services to interact with vision systems and control machine learning workflows.
  • Database Integration: Work with Google Cloud-based databases to manage large datasets, including real-time image/video processing and model result storage.
  • API Development & Integration: Develop RESTful APIs for seamless interaction between AI vision systems, edge devices, and cloud services. Ensure smooth integration with other systems and services.
  • Cross-Functional Collaboration: Work closely with product managers, data scientists, and hardware engineers to translate business requirements into technical solutions.
  • Code Quality & Testing: Write clean, maintainable, and efficient code. Implement unit and integration tests to ensure the reliability and performance of the system.
  • Continuous Improvement: Keep up to date with the latest trends in AI, machine learning, and edge computing, and incorporate best practices into the software development lifecycle.
  • Troubleshooting & Debugging: Diagnose and resolve issues related to machine learning models, APIs, edge computing performance, and database integration.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Artificial Intelligence Software Engineer

Data Analysis Incorporated

null null

Remote

Remote

USD 100,000 - 140,000

Full time

Today
Be an early applicant

Senior Full Stack Software Engineer- AI Remote-Canada or Remote-USA

Plotly Dash Enterprise

Iowa null

Remote

Remote

USD 100,000 - 150,000

Full time

7 days ago
Be an early applicant

AI Software Engineer

Anika Systems

Leesburg null

Remote

Remote

USD 100,000 - 150,000

Full time

12 days ago

Software Engineer, AI Solutions

General Motors

null null

Remote

Remote

USD 100,000 - 160,000

Full time

13 days ago

AI Software Engineer

Ports North

Austin null

Remote

Remote

USD 100,000 - 160,000

Full time

13 days ago

AI Software Developer

NexTier Completion Solutions

Houston null

Remote

Remote

USD 100,000 - 125,000

Full time

Yesterday
Be an early applicant

AI/ML Software Engineer

Vividly

null null

Remote

Remote

USD 100,000 - 150,000

Full time

Today
Be an early applicant

Part-Time AI Software Engineer Sr

Lockheed Martin

King of Prussia null

Remote

Remote

USD 104,000 - 185,000

Part time

Yesterday
Be an early applicant

Senior AI Software Engineer

ZipRecruiter

Austin null

Remote

Remote

USD 120,000 - 160,000

Full time

3 days ago
Be an early applicant